英文摘要
We studied on the construction and elucidation of functions of unsymmetrical molecular capsules self-assembled by hydrogen bonds or metal-coordinations. Our findings in this study are as follows.(1) We synthesized bowl-shaped cavitands 1〜7 with hydrogen-bonding sites or metal-coordination sites. We found that 1 and 3, 4 and 5, and 4, 6, and Pd(dppp)(OTf)_2, self-assemble into hydrogen-bonded heterocapsules 1・3 and 4・5, and metal-coordination heterocapsule 4・6・4[Pd(dppp)]^(8+), respectively.(2) We found that these heterocapsules encapsulate unsymmetrical guests with high orientational selectivity what is called "orientational isomerism".(3) The structural and/or electronic environments of one half-capsule unit of the heterocapsule are different from those of the other half-capsule unit. We found that the delicate balance among electrostatic potential repulsion between the lone pair of the carbonyl oxygen atom of a guest and the aromatic cavity of a cavitand, attractive CH-πinteraction, or attractive CH-halogen (halogen-π) interaction in a heterocapsule-guest assembly influences the orientational isomeric selectivity of unsymmetrical guests within heterocapsule.(4) Fine and/or drastic tuning of capsule space has been attained by alteration of the hydrogen-bonding linker and/or hemispherical cavitand, respectively.
